DESCRIPTION
Dahlia 'Otto's Thrill' is a stunning dahlia variety known for its huge dinnerplate-size blossoms in a delightful cotton candy pink hue. The petal edges fade to blush and the blossom centers are a dark raspberry color, adding depth and contrast to the overall appearance. The blossoms of 'Otto's Thrill' are soft and have a cottage garden appearance, making them charming additions to any garden or floral arrangement. 'Otto's Thrill' belongs to the informal decorative group, characterized by its double blooms that are not fully formal in shape. These dahlias have overlapping petals that can be slightly twisted or irregular, giving them a relaxed, informal appearance. With its stunning blooms and strong stems, 'Otto's Thrill' is sure to be a standout in any garden setting.

  • Bloom Color: Light Pink
    Bloom Size: 10 in
    Form: Informal Decorative
    Plant Height: 4-5 ft

    Dahlias are generally low-maintenance. They do best in well-draining soil and prefer full sun for optimal growth and flowering. Tubers can be planted outside after the last frost. Nourish with a balanced fertilizer once the plants are established.

    Throughout the growing season, provide regular watering, support for tall varieties, and deadhead spent flowers to encourage more blooms. Harvest blossoms when buds are 3/4 open.
